The best method for the separation of naphthalene and benzoic acid from their mixture is

(a) distillation 

(b) sublimation

(c) chromatography 

(d) crystallisation.

The correct option is: (b) sublimation

Explanation:

Sublimation method is used for those organic substances which pass directly from solid to vapour state on heating and vice-versa on cooling. e.g. benzoic acid, naphthalene, camphor, anthracene, etc. Naphthalene is volatile and benzoic acid is non-volatile due to the formation of the dimer.
